The Role

This position is responsible for Field Services and to perform installation, commissioning, maintenance and repair services for Schneider’s range of cooling and refrigeration product lines, which includes UPS, STS, PTU, Battery solution and cooling. The candidate will be expected to be familiar with all aspects of the power system.

What you will do
  • Installation and commissioning of UPS system within data centers, ensuring proper setup, integration, and optimal performance.
  • Perform routine maintenance, calibrations, and repairs on UPS systems. Troubleshoot UPS system, PTU, resolving them quickly to minimize downtime.
  • Maintenance / Repair: The candidate will be expected to complete planned and unscheduled maintenance on the Schneider Electric product range.
  • Maintain accurate service records, ensuring all work complies with safety regulations and manufacturer guidelines. Provide clients with clear reports on system status and recommended actions.
  • Build and maintain client relationships by providing expert advice on system optimization, cooling loads, and thermal management to ensure peak operational performance.
  • Ensure all service work adheres to safety standards, regulations, and best practices, creating a safe work environment at all times.
  • Respond promptly to emergency breakdowns, prioritize repairs, and restore cooling systems swiftly to minimize disruptions to critical data center operations.
  • 24x7 on Call: The candidate will need to be prepared to attend customer sites at short notice to perform diagnosis and repairs.
What qualifications will make you successful?
  • Diploma / Bachelor's degree in Electrical Electronic Engineering or related field (preferred).
  • Prior experience on UPS and Cooling in Data Centre will be a strong advantage.
  • Minimum of 1-2 years of experience in UPS field services, with a focus on data centers or high-performance environments.
  • In-depth knowledge of UPS, electrical systems, PTU systems and mechanical troubleshooting techniques.
  • Proficient in the use of diagnostic tools and software for UPS systems.
  • Must be able to communicate (speak and hear) with the ability to interact professionally with clients, vendors, and cross‑functional teams.
  • Strong attention to detail, problem‑solving skills, and the ability to manage time effectively.
  • Open to fresh graduates.
  • Must be willing to be base in Johor Bahru.
